How to Calculate Cube Root
The cube root of a number is a value that, when multiplied by itself three times, gives the original number. For example, the cube root of 27 is 3 because 3 × 3 × 3 = 27.
While you can use a calculator for cube roots, knowing the trick can help you estimate cube roots quickly without one. Here's how it works:
- Find the prime factorization of the number.
- Group the prime factors into triplets.
- Multiply one factor from each triplet to get the cube root.
This method works best for perfect cubes, but it can also be adapted for non-perfect cubes with some estimation.
The Formula
The mathematical formula for the cube root of a number \( x \) is:
\( \sqrt[3]{x} = x^{1/3} \)
This formula means that the cube root of \( x \) is equal to \( x \) raised to the power of one-third.
For example, \( \sqrt[3]{64} = 64^{1/3} = 4 \) because \( 4 \times 4 \times 4 = 64 \).
Worked Examples
Example 1: Calculating the Cube Root of 27
To find the cube root of 27:
- Find the prime factors of 27: 3 × 3 × 3.
- Group the factors into triplets: (3 × 3 × 3).
- Multiply one factor from each triplet: 3.
The cube root of 27 is 3.
Example 2: Calculating the Cube Root of 125
To find the cube root of 125:
- Find the prime factors of 125: 5 × 5 × 5.
- Group the factors into triplets: (5 × 5 × 5).
- Multiply one factor from each triplet: 5.
The cube root of 125 is 5.

FAQ
- What is the difference between a square root and a cube root?
- A square root is a number that, when multiplied by itself, gives the original number. A cube root is a number that, when multiplied by itself three times, gives the original number.
- Can I use this trick for non-perfect cubes?
- Yes, but it requires estimation. You can use the nearest perfect cubes to approximate the cube root of a non-perfect cube.
- How do I calculate the cube root of a negative number?
- The cube root of a negative number is negative. For example, the cube root of -8 is -2 because (-2) × (-2) × (-2) = -8.
- What is the cube root of zero?
- The cube root of zero is zero because 0 × 0 × 0 = 0.
- How can I verify the cube root of a number?
- You can verify the cube root by multiplying the root by itself three times and checking if the result matches the original number.
